I should point out that it isn't necessary for you to meditate any longer than 20 minutes. For many individuals, two sessions of 20 minutes per day is all they ever do, as a result of that’s all they ever need to feel peaceable and happy in life. But if you're actually enjoying your meditation then I most certainly Guided Meditation for Social Anxiety perceive when you really feel compelled to deepen it further nonetheless. This journey into stillness and serenity could be extraordinarily exciting and rewarding. Meditation is like working towards a musical instrument. You begin small at about minutes per day then improve the amount of time you apply as you feel comfortable. Do what you possibly can though should you really feel like you could follow more by all means you need to. Far extra important than figuring out the "appropriate" period of time to take a seat, is maintaining consistency. Meditation ought to be something that just turns into an everyday fixture of your life, like eating and sleeping. When I was taught to meditate the meditations in the class have been usually forty or 50 minutes long. I picked up the concept that anything shorter than that wasn’t a “real” meditation and didn’t actually matter. That was a most unlucky thought to choose up, as a result of there have been many days I couldn’t do that amount of meditation and so I ended up not sitting — although I did have time to do 15 or 20 minutes. Hi Yasir, What you’re doing sounds about proper. As a beginner, you will most likely find that after 20 minutes your meditation is not going to become a lot deeper, so there’s not an excessive amount of level in pushing on. You can also discover that you feel so relaxed after the primary 20 minutes that you're able to drift off to sleep. If this occurs, then the second half of your meditation will most likely be more of a drowsy daydream than a real meditation. They could also be inspired by photographs of Buddhist practitioners, monks or nuns, who appear to meditate blissfully for hours without taking a break. Most individuals who sit for lengthy durations have trained progressively over months and years. Especially for those who meditate on their very own, intensive sitting requires a high diploma of practice and discipline.
